9:30 – 10:30 a.m. Friendship Hall Barbara Leland will lead a discussion on Restorative Justice Practices. The U.S. justice system is oriented toward punishment, which is reactive justice. Punishment does not teach the responsible person, nor heal the affected person. Restorative Justice Practices is a paradigm shift, a philosophy implemented in many cultures and in many school systems.
